The author is an expert at preparing candidates for WebThere are a total of sixty-six questions on the AP biology exam. You will have ninety minutes to answer sixty multiple-choice questions, which means you have a little more than a minute to answer the questions. You will be asked to answer six free-response questions also in ninety minutes, so you will have plenty of time to develop well-thought ...

WebThe subject matter tested covers the broad field of the biological sciences, organized into three major areas: molecular and cellular biology, organismal biology, and population biology. The exam gives approximately equal weight to these three areas. The exam contains approximately 115 questions to be answered in 90 minutes.
